I have a laptop with a keyboard issue.
Using windows 8. When getting the to windows login screen the "M" key works like the enter key and the "-" and "space" key only apply spaces. all other keys do Nothing.

I can reboot the computer and it might work correctly. more often than not it has the symptoms above.

I tried safe mode once and I get the above symptoms.
Was working fine one day, set the laptop on the table came back to it and this is what happened. Nobody else touched it in between that time. never been dropped.

I was able to get the onscreen keyboard to come up and it has the exact same issues.
F11 works on boot up to access safe mode.
